Materials & Body
The body is crafted from robust cast aluminum, the material that gives this Pro Aluminum Darbuka its longevity and its bright, resonant voice. The glossy green lacquer with twin gold rings around the shoulder and waist is more than decoration: the rigid metal shell projects sound cleanly, producing the sharp tek and the round, full dum that define a professional darbuka.

Head/Skin & Tuning
Fitted with a finely tuned synthetic head across the 23 cm rim, the darbuka delivers a wide expressive range, from powerful percussive strikes to clear melodic tones. The tuning bolts let you adjust head tension to suit your playing style and the room, a flexibility that matters in both solo and ensemble settings.

Care & Maintenance
To keep your darbuka in top condition, wipe the surface regularly with a soft, dry cloth and avoid extreme temperatures. Store it in the included gig bag to protect it from dust and knocks, and check the drumhead tension from time to time for consistent sound.
